Output 5e72511e2883f2037506b828bc435ac7ecdf1e9a982c275effbe005115e0ad6e:62

value
17953526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1968246915ba8646e7e7c0b40530df065bc6abe8 OP_EQUAL
address
341MaGXAEA5KNw5eicoTGCmkKru2VTsSGV
transaction
5e72511e2883f2037506b828bc435ac7ecdf1e9a982c275effbe005115e0ad6e
spent
true